Neuropathic symptoms occur because of damage to the PNS.Ī person’s symptoms, if they have any, could depend on the type of nerves that have the damage. More research is necessary to determine whether a cause-effect relationship is present. Reports of peripheral neuropathies do not prove that the COVID-19 vaccine is the cause. This contrasts markedly with the dangers of a severe COVID-19 infection. While the authors acknowledge that some of the more serious effects are potentially fatal, nearly all the effects are treatable if doctors find them early. Therefore, the benefits outweigh the risks for most people, according to the review authors. The number of reports of serious peripheral neuropathies is very small compared with the number of people who have received the vaccines. These conditions are called peripheral neuropathies. Some of these conditions affect the peripheral nervous system (PNS), the network of nerves that sends and receives messages to and from the brain and spinal cord. Still, rare reports have involved serious neurological conditions.
